§80‑35.  Distinctive name required.

No name shall be registered asthe name of a farm where such proposed name or one so nearly like it as toproduce confusion has been so used in connection with another farm in the samecounty as to become generally known prior to March 5, 1915, unless the nameused has also prior to March 5, 1915, become well known as the name of the farmproposed to be registered; and in this event two or more farms in the samecounty may be registered with the same name with some prefix or suffix added todistinguish them. (1915, c. 108, s. 2; C.S., s. 4006.)
